The Rise of AI-Assisted Learning

The use of AI as a learning tool among developers is on the rise. A recent pulse survey revealed that 64% of developers now use AI to learn, a significant increase from 44% in 2024 and 37% in 2023. This growth is driven by a desire to “start from scratch” (28.2%) and improve “efficiency” (26.3%). Developers are increasingly turning to AI for just-in-time solutions and to overcome the barrier of a blank page.

Consolidation of Learning Resources

Interestingly, the increased use of AI doesn’t necessarily translate to an expansion of the total number of learning resources used. Instead, there’s a trend toward consolidation. In 2024, approximately 49% of developers used eight or more learning resources. This number dropped to 9% in 2025 and further to 7% in the recent survey. This suggests that AI is becoming a central hub, integrating with other resources rather than replacing them entirely.

AI Adoption Varies by Experience Level

AI adoption isn’t uniform across all experience levels. While 68% of early-career developers use AI daily at work, this figure drops to 59% for mid-career and 56% for experienced developers. Experienced developers are more likely to prioritize technical documentation as a first step in their learning journey (30% favor documentation vs. 29% for AI tools), while younger developers lean more heavily on AI (36% of early-career developers and 39% of mid-career developers turn to AI first).

Time as a Barrier to Learning

A significant barrier to learning, particularly for developers not currently using AI, is a lack of time. 35% of those developers cited time constraints as the primary reason, exceeding concerns about low motivation (11%) or not knowing where to start (10%). For developers who *do* use AI, time is a less significant obstacle (7%), suggesting that AI tools help alleviate time pressures.

The Trust Gap and the ‘AI Tax’

Despite its benefits, trust remains a major hurdle for AI-assisted learning. 38% of developers express a lack of trust in AI-generated results. This concern is particularly pronounced among experienced developers. This lack of trust is contributing to what’s being termed the “AI tax”—the necessitate for developers to validate AI-provided information with other sources, adding an extra step to the learning process.

The concept of the “AI tax” stems from the way Large Language Models (LLMs) operate. As information architect Jessica Talisman points out, LLMs can “mimic the documentary chain of citations and footnotes without satisfying its duty in maintaining provenance.” This lack of verifiable sourcing creates uncertainty and necessitates independent verification.

Cautious Optimism About AI-Driven Platforms

Developers are cautiously optimistic about the potential of AI-driven platforms for certification and job searching. While 57% believe AI has improved in its suitability for learning, only 44% would find a certification from an AI platform valuable. Interest in AI agents representing developers in job searches is conditional, with 46% requiring human intervention at every step and 44% prioritizing data transparency.

Continued Reliance on Traditional Resources

Even as AI becomes more prevalent, developers continue to rely on traditional learning resources. The vast majority (58%) use AI in conjunction with technical documentation, 54% with other online resources (search, forums, online communities), and 50% with Stack Overflow. This indicates that AI is being used as a supplement to, rather than a replacement for, established learning methods.
